Hi all
If I have an AVI file movie on my media drive, When I connect the drive to my 42" plasma and play it the picture is only about 12" high. If i use convertXtoDVD to burn it to dvd & then play it through my dvd player the TV screen is filled. Is there any way to make the AVI file fill the screen on my tv(like a normal movie) or do I just have to keep burning to dvd.
